Take It To The Next Level - Lessons Learned Provide Opportunity

The current Featured Article on TruckSavvy.com is a must read.

Titled Lessons Learned Provide Opportunity, the article chronicles some of the challenges encountered during the first winter of operation with Utra Low Sulfur Diesel Fuel.

It also discusses how one Midwest fleet has taken those lessons and the expertise of supplier companies to raise the value of his APU (Auxiliary Power Units) installations. 

The fleet has reengineered commercially available systems to provide cab comfort and improve fleet performance in harsh conditions and ensure vehicles start and keep running, even in the coldest conditions.

Cool Stuff Revisited - Get The Whole Picture With The SideTracker

We featured The SideTracker video system in a previous edition of Savvy Pro News.

The SideTracker uses a wide angle camera to send a real time image of the "No Zone" blind spot to the right of the vehicle and gives drivers a clearer view of traffic, obstacles and potential hazards.

The manufacturer has recently added night vision capability and have a new web site and video describing the SideTracker.
